Output 8aacbb08233dea98bd02f6942b0d5d457e5d2cecaee63eea84a194d3e4e914fe:1

value
68414400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c17468fd20fc11d6424e91919e5d1e2adcd4089 OP_EQUAL
address
3Qfx6714qBcPxqiYbXVekPLodZ2PoS7zHe
transaction
8aacbb08233dea98bd02f6942b0d5d457e5d2cecaee63eea84a194d3e4e914fe
confirmations
349020
spent
true